We are seeking a detail-oriented and analytically strong finance professional to support the accurate and timely consolidation of monthly financial results across all ASC business units. This role plays a critical part in ensuring that leadership has a clear, reliable view of business performance. This is a fixed-term position initially for 6 months, with the potential to become permanent. We offer flexible working arrangements, and when on-site, you’ll be based at our Bradford office (BD12). In return, we offer a salary of £40,000–£50,000, depending on experience, along with a structured development plan that includes training and mentorship to support your career growth.

Working closely with teams across the organisation, you will gather and validate financial data, maintain robust financial models, and ensure these are accurately reflected in our FP&A systems—including Anaplan—and other key internal reporting tools. You will also support the Head of FP&A throughout the full forecasting and budgeting cycles, contributing insights and analysis that drive effective decision-making. Your work will help shape the accuracy, integrity, and effectiveness of ASC’s financial planning and reporting framework.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Support the delivery of the monthly reporting cycle by consolidating actual results across all ASC Business Units, preparing management reports, and providing first-level variance analysis and commentary.
  • Prepare and consolidate forecast and budget inputs in collaboration with the site finance teams, ensuring the accuracy, relevance, and timeliness of all forecast data.
  • Develop detailed financial models, reports, and data insights to support the analysis of actual results and inform forecasts and budgets.
  • Compile comprehensive sales-per-customer reporting and produce ranking analyses to identify top-performing customers.
  • Prepare management reporting packs and business reviews that effectively communicate clear, actionable insights to key stakeholders.
  • Monitor financial KPIs, proactively identifying trends, risks, and opportunities to drive operational and financial efficiencies.

Skills, Knowledge & Expertise:

  • ACCA / CIMA qualified or part qualified.
  • Advanced Excel modelling (driver-based forecasting, scenario analysis, sensitivity modelling).
  • Strong understanding of P&L, Balance Sheet, and Cash Flow interdependencies, with the ability to build and link all three statements.
  • Proficient in producing variance and trend analyses, including clear and insightful bridges to explain key drivers.
  • Strong communicator with the ability to engage effectively with stakeholders at all levels of the business.

✨Know Your Numbers

As an FP&A Analyst, you'll be dealing with financial data all the time. Brush up on your understanding of P&L, Balance Sheet, and Cash Flow interdependencies. Be ready to discuss how you’ve used these in past roles, especially in building financial models or conducting variance analyses.

✨Excel Skills are Key

Make sure you're comfortable with advanced Excel functions, especially driver-based forecasting and scenario analysis. During the interview, you might be asked about specific modelling techniques you've used, so have some examples ready to showcase your skills.

✨Communicate Clearly

Strong communication is crucial for this role. Practice explaining complex financial concepts in simple terms. You may need to present insights to stakeholders, so think about how you can convey your findings effectively and engage your audience.

✨Show Your Analytical Side

Prepare to discuss how you've identified trends, risks, and opportunities in previous roles. Think of specific examples where your analysis led to actionable insights or improved decision-making. This will demonstrate your ability to contribute meaningfully to the team.
